The Dawn of Physical AI and Humanoid Robotics

Physical AI refers to AI systems embodied in physical forms—robots that can perceive, reason, and act in real-world environments. Unlike virtual AI confined to screens, Physical AI promises transformative applications: from household assistants and manufacturing aides to exploration bots in hazardous areas. Humanoid robotics, in particular, mimics human form and dexterity, making them versatile for tasks requiring manipulation, mobility, and social interaction.

Recent advancements have accelerated this field. Companies like Tesla with Optimus, Figure AI, and Boston Dynamics are pushing boundaries, but their centralized models limit participation. Ownership is concentrated among venture capitalists and corporations, governance is top-down, and innovation favors proprietary silos. This leaves innovators, small builders, and enthusiasts on the sidelines.
